Table 1.

Strains and plasmids used in this study

Strain or plasmid Characteristic(s)a Source or reference
Strains
    P. aeruginosa PA14
        WT Clinical isolate UCBPP-PA14 38
        ΔbqsR mutant Deletion in bqsR This study
        ΔbqsR mutant and pMQ64 Deletion in bqsR; contains plasmid pMQ64 This study
        ΔbqsR mutant and pMQ64-bqsR Deletion in bqsR; contains plasmid pMQ64-bqsR This study
        ΔbqsS mutant Deletion in bqsS This study
        feoB mutant feoB::MAR2xT7; transposon mutant containing Gmr cassette 26
    E. coli
        UQ950 E. coli DH5α λ(pir) host for cloning; F-Δ(argF-lac)169 θ80 dlacZ58(ΔM15) glnV44(AS) rfbD1 gyrA96(Nalr) recA1 endA1 spoT1 thi-1 hsdR17 deoR λpir+ D. Lies, Caltech
        BW29427 Donor strain for conjugation; thrB1004 pro thi rpsL hsdS lacZ ΔM15RP4-1360 Δ(araBAD)567 ΔdapA1341::[erm pir(wt)] W. Metcalf, University of Illinois
    S. cerevisiae
        InvSc1 MATa/MATα leu2/leu2 trp1-289/trp1-289 ura3-52/ura3-52 his3-Δ1/his3-Δ1 Invitrogen
Plasmids
    pMQ30 pEX18-Gmr, URA3, CEN6, ARSH4; allelic replacement vector 42
    pΔbqsR 2-kb fusion PCR fragment containing the ΔbqsR mutant cloned into the BamHI/EcoRI site of pMQ30; used to make the ΔbqsR mutant This study
    pΔbqsS 2-kb fusion PCR fragment containing the ΔbqsS mutant cloned into the BamHI/EcoRI site of pMQ30; used to make the ΔbqsS mutant This study
    pMQ64 pMQ30 with a deletion of SacB 42
    pMQ64-bqsR bqsR cloned into pMQ64 This study
a

Gmr, gentamicin resistant; Nalr, nalidixic acid resistant.
